Enjoy and have a wonderful day today: https://youtube/watch?v=RFh9rFRxTp4 David Rudder was born May 6, 1953 in Belmont, Trinidad. David Rudder is one of the most successful calypsonians of all time. In 1977, he joined Charlies Roots, a leading band in Trinidad and Tobago, and spent many years as one of the bands vocalists. In 1986 he came to prominence on Andy Narells album The Hammer, which produced two big hits: The Hammer (a tribute to the late pannist Rudolph Charles) and Bahia Girl. This was followed in 1987 with Calypso Music, a brilliant encapsulation of the history of calypso. For more: en.wikipedia.org/wiki/David_Rudder
